Dr. Andreas Emil Feldmann holds the position of Senior Lecturer in Algorithms at the University of Sheffield's School of Computer Science since 2023. His academic journey includes a Diploma in Computer Science from RWTH Aachen (2007), a Doctor of Sciences from ETH Zurich (2012), and a habilitation from Charles University in Prague (2021). He has held postdoctoral positions at the University of Waterloo (2012–2015) and the Hungarian Academy of Sciences (2015). His research focuses on combinatorial optimization, parameterized approximation algorithms, network design, and clustering, with notable contributions to survivable network design, highway dimension graphs, and algorithmic lower bounds. He has organized workshops like the Parameterized Approximation Algorithms Workshop (PAAW) and serves on program committees for major conferences such as ICALP and IPEC. His work has been recognized, including a 2022 teaching award at Charles University.
